The storm shut down major airports until early Thursday evening, including John F. Kennedy International Airport and LaGuardia Airport in New York and Logan International Airport in Boston. Baltimore-Washington International Airport and Philadelphia International Airport remained open. Newark Liberty International Airport had one runway open, but flights couldn't land due to strong crosswinds.

The state of Arizona is going after Amazon for million in back taxes for the period of March 2006 through December 2010, alleging that Amazon should have been collecting a transaction tax during those periods. That’s in addition to the 9 million that texas is trying to collect from Amazon on similar grounds. Amazon is fighting both assessments. The company says SEC staff notified Amazon in late 2011 that it had completed its inquiry into the Texas assessment.
